Spatial Touchโ„ข features and specs

  • Intuitive Interaction
    Spatial Touch technology aims to make user interaction more natural and intuitive by allowing users to interact with content in a three-dimensional space, reducing the learning curve for new users.
  • Enhanced Immersion
    By supporting spatial and gesture-based input, it can create a more immersive experience, particularly useful in AR/VR, gaming, and interactive display applications.
  • Hands-Free Potential
    Depending on implementation, spatial touch can enable gesture control without physical contact, which is beneficial in hygienic environments or hands-busy scenarios.
  • Modern User Experience
    It offers a cutting-edge, futuristic interface that can differentiate a product and appeal to users seeking innovative technology.
  • Accessibility Opportunities
    Spatial and gesture-based controls can provide alternative input methods that may benefit users who have difficulty with traditional touchscreens or physical buttons.

Possible disadvantages of Spatial Touchโ„ข

  • Unverified Link
    The information is behind a shortened URL that cannot be independently verified, making it difficult to confirm the actual features, capabilities, or claims of the product.
  • Learning Curve
    Despite claims of intuitiveness, spatial and gesture-based interfaces often require users to learn new gestures or movements, which can be frustrating initially.
  • Hardware Requirements
    Spatial touch typically depends on specialized sensors, cameras, or hardware, which can increase cost and limit compatibility with existing devices.
  • Accuracy and Reliability Issues
    Gesture and spatial recognition can suffer from misinterpretation, latency, or environmental interference such as poor lighting, leading to inconsistent performance.
  • Physical Fatigue
    Sustained mid-air gestures or spatial interactions can cause user fatigue over time, a common issue known as 'gorilla arm' in touchless interface designs.
